Situation
Grantham is located on the River Witham, in the county of Lincolnshire, approximately 120 miles North of London and 25 miles South of Lincoln. Surrounded by agricultural land towards the western side of the Kesteven uplands, it is an ancient and attractive red-brick town, with the 281ft high spire of St.Wulfram's Church one of its dominating features. Grantham's historical strategic significance ensured a turbulent past but in more recent times it has become renowned as the birthplace of Margaret Thatcher, Britain's first woman Prime Minister. There is a large selection of independent retailers and high street stores offering an eclectic mix of goods and services. Grantham is ideally placed for commuter links with the A1 easily accessible for travel North and South. In addition, Grantham Railway Station is on the East Coast mainline and regular trains to London take approximately 70 minutes.

Accommodation
Upon entering the front door, this leads into:

Lounge - 11' 7'' x 11' 2'' (3.53m x 3.40m) (at it's widest points)
This nicely proportioned reception room has a window to the front elevation. The lounge has a gas fire, a ceiling light point and a radiator. From the lounge a glazed door leads through to the inner hallway.

Inner Hallway
The inner hallway has the staircase rising to the first floor, beneath which is sited a large and useful storage cupboard. There is also an opening leading through to the dining room.

Dining Room - 11' 7'' x 11' 1'' (3.53m x 3.38m) (at it's widest points)
This second reception room is also of a very good size and is well proportioned, with a window to the rear elevation and a door providing access through to the kitchen. The dining room has a ceiling light point and a radiator installed.

Kitchen - 14' 1'' x 4' 11'' (4.29m x 1.50m)
This long galley style kitchen has a window to the side elevation, and a half glazed door leading out to the rear garden. The kitchen currently has base and wall units, a stainless steel sink and space and plumbing for a washing machine. The central heating boiler (not tested) is located within the kitchen. In addition there are twin ceiling light points and a radiator.

First Floor Landing
The dogleg staircase rises from the inner hallway to the first floor landing which provides access to both bedrooms and the bathroom. In addition, from the first floor landing, the staircase continues and provides access to the attic room.

Bedroom One - 11' 7'' x 11' 3'' (3.53m x 3.43m) (at it's widest points)
An excellent sized double bedroom with a window to the front elevation, a ceiling light point and a radiator.

Bedroom Two - 11' 2'' x 5' 11'' (3.40m x 1.80m) (plus door recess)
The second bedroom has a window to the rear elevation, a radiator and a ceiling light point.

Bathroom - 8' 3'' x 5' 5'' (2.51m x 1.65m)
The bathroom has a window to the rear elevation and is fitted with a bath, WC, and pedestal wash hand basin. The bathroom has a useful fitted storage cupboard and a ceiling light point.

Attic Room - 12' 11'' x 10' 4'' (3.93m x 3.15m)
Access to the attic room is obtained via the staircase from the first floor landing. The attic room has a Velux skylight window to the rear elevation, wall lighting, and provides a most useful and versatile space.

Outside
To the rear of the property there is an enclosed courtyard garden with further gated access to the rear.

Council Tax
This property is in Band A.
